
Duncan Castles has shared on The Transfer Window Podcast what Portuguese football experts have told him about reported Arsenal target Nuno Tavares.
The well-known and well-respected journalist has said that experts have told him that Tavares, who is set to join Arsenal from Benfica in the summer transfer window, is a very good attacking full-back.
However, the 21-year-old Portuguese left-back is defensively susceptible and has a difficult personalty, according to Castles.
Castles said about Tavares on The Transfer Window Podcast: “People I speak to who are paid to assess the quality of Portuguese football say that he is a difficult personality but a very good attacking full-back with defensive frailties.”
Arsenal interest
Arsenal are interested in signing Tavares from Benfica in the summer transfer window, according to The Daily Mail.
The Gunners are on the verge of securing the services of the 21-year-old left-back for £7 million.
Real Sociedad made a late attempt, but the Portuguese youngster is on his way to the Gunners.
The transfer will reportedly go through in the next few days.

Good signing for Arsenal?
Tavares is only 21, and it is clear that he is a player who is still developing and improving.
The Portuguese is not the finished article yet, and Arsenal will know what.
The Gunners are bringing in the Benfica youngster as cover for Kieran Tierney.

Tierney is the first-choice left-back at Arsenal and is one of the best in his position in Europe.
Tavares will play back-up to him, and training with Tierney and working under manager Mikel Arteta on a daily basis will help him improve his game.
The 21-year-old made seven starts and seven substitute appearances in the Portuguese league last season.
The youngster also made three starts and two substitute appearances in the Europa League.
